Summary of Job Duties:

The Supply Coordinator supports intraoperative quality and resource management, advises on operational improvements, cost containment, and supply utilization. Requires knowledge of supply chain and clinical experience, along with communication and leadership skills.

Qualifications:

Minimum Qualifications: Bachelor's Degree or HS Diploma plus 4 years of healthcare experience, including 2 years in inventory management and 2 years in a hospital setting.

Responsibilities:
  • Daily rounds in OR and Nursing Areas to communicate with staff and update preference cards/supply needs.
  • Collaborate with Clinical Coordinators on preference cards and supplies.
  • Identify waste and over/under-used items post-surgery to reduce costs.
  • Work with Supply Chain to identify cost-effective materials and implement changes.
  • Coordinate with vendors and staff on new product trials and conversions.
  • Maintain records for reporting and system improvements.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
